Ingredients of Spinach Mushroom Sourdough Strata:
- Two tablespoons of unsalted butter
- One medium onion, fully chopped
- Eight ounces of sliced mushrooms
- 1 10-oz. package frozen completely chopped spinach, thawed, squeezed dry
- Salt and pepper just to taste
- Eight slices of hearty white bread, cubed
- One and a half cups shredded Swiss cheese
- Two cups of whole milk
- Five large eggs
- One tablespoon of Dijon mustard
The Cooking Method of Spinach Strata:
Step #1
Firstly preheat your oven to 375°F. And then grease a 2 1/2-quart baking dish with the help of cooking spray. In a large-size skillet, you’ve to melt butter over medium-high heat.
Step #2
After that, add onion and mushrooms; cook, stirring, until it becomes soft and golden, about six minutes. Now, remove it from heat. Add some spinach, mix very well and season it with salt and pepper just to taste.
Step #3
Here you have to spread about 1/3 of the bread cubes on the bottom of the baking dish, then half of the vegetable mixture and 1/3 of the cheese. Repeat it with 1/3 of bread, all the remaining vegetables, and another 1/3 of cheese. You can also top it with the remaining bread and cheese.
Step #4
In a large-size bowl, you have to whisk together milk, eggs, and mustard and season it with salt and pepper. Pour over strata and then press down on the bread mixture with the back of your spoon to moisten.
Step #5
Lastly, bake it until strata are fully set and the center is puffed and golden, for forty-five to fifty minutes. Serve it immediately.
